> This will be an issue that needs to be addressed for RedHat Satellite
> During a base install, when choosing RH Satellite, the operating systems are
> created then updated with an empty array for repositories: []
> When doing the same in ambari-admin, repositories fields is not empty. We
> need to make the two consistent as RH Satellite needs the
> ambari_managed_repositories field.
